Venture Global LNG (“Venture Global”) is a long-term, low-cost
provider of American-produced liquefied natural gas. The company’s
two Louisiana-based export projects service the global demand for
North American natural gas and support the long-term development of
clean and reliable North American energy supplies. Using reliable,
proven technology in an innovative plant design configuration,
Venture Global’s modular, mid-scale plant design will replace
traditional designs as it allows for the same efficiency and
operational reliability at significantly lower capital cost.
Position Summary The Facilities Manager located in Arlington, is
responsible for ensuring a well-run, safe and efficient office
environment for the organization. This role supervises a small
team, manages vendor and facilities relationships, oversees office
administration and procurement. The manager is the primary point of
contact for day-to-day office operations and contributes to
continuous improvement initiatives. Key Responsibilities Lead,
coach and develop a team of 3 office services staff; set
priorities, conduct regular 1:1s, perform performance reviews and
manage staffing coverage and schedules. Oversee daily front-desk,
mail/courier, visitor management and office reception services to
ensure a professional employee and guest experience. Manage
facilities operations including office maintenance, small repairs,
building services coordination, and office moves. Ability to
respond 24/7 emergency alarm notifications as needed. Own office
supplies and non-capital procurement for the office; manage vendor
relationships, obtain quotes, maintain purchase documentation and
control budgets in coordination with Procurement Develop and manage
the facilities budget. Monitor expenses and identify cost-saving
opportunities. Manage relationships with third-party service
providers, including negotiating contracts and overseeing their
performance. Source and manage contractors for major repairs or new
installations. Responsible for the oversight and coordination of
break room management, office supply replenishment, and mail
services, ensuring timely stocking, coffee preparation, food
orders, inventory accuracy, and efficient package handling. Survey
office space daily for furniture damage, non-working appliances,
burned out lights, etc. Issue security keys and set up parking
accounts. Coordinate with IT for desktop/equipment provisioning,
audio-visual setup for meetings and events. Plan and support
on-site events, meetings and executive logistics (meeting room
set-up, catering). Ensure office health & safety, security access,
and emergency preparedness; coordinate with building management and
internal stakeholders. Develop and document standard operating
procedures for office services; support cross-training and
succession planning. Qualifications 8 years’ experience in office
services, facilities or administrative management; minimum 3 years
in a supervisory role preferred. Strong vendor management and
procurement experience; familiarity with purchasing processes.
Comfortable coordinating with IT and other internal partners for
endpoint/device provisioning and service requests. Proven ability
to manage budgets and control costs. Excellent organizational,
communication and interpersonal skills; customer-service oriented.
Competency with office productivity tools (email, calendar systems,
Microsoft Office) Knowledge of office security, data handling and
acceptable use practices is preferred Bachelor’s degree preferred
but not required; or equivalent work experience. Skills &
Competencies People leadership: coaching, performance management,
conflict resolution. Project and vendor management Problem solving
and decision making under time constraints. Attention to detail and
process orientation. Confidentiality and professionalism when
handling sensitive information. Working Conditions On-site presence
required during core business hours; manage team coverage to align
with company office presence expectations. Occasional after-hours
or weekend coordination may be required for major events or
emergency facility issues. Ability to lift 20-30 pounds Venture
